📚Bağlam ve Tarihsel Perspektif

Musk co-founded OpenAI but has since expressed dissatisfaction with its trajectory and leadership. His lawsuit against Altman is part of a broader narrative about the power dynamics in technology and the responsibilities of those at the helm of influential organizations. The outcome of this case could influence public perception and regulatory approaches to AI and tech governance.
